Original Tender Description

This is a four year DPS framework agreement under which we will run further competitions for home to school transport services. All operators that meet the criteria to be on the framework agreement will get the opportunity to bid in further competitions for specific routes at any time during the DPS.

MANDATORY EXCLUSION GROUNDS

  • Operators must not be subject to any mandatory exclusion grounds as defined by relevant public procurement regulations (e.g., UK Public Contracts Regulations 2015).

ELIGIBILITY REQUIREMENTS

  • Operators must be legally constituted and registered to operate transport services in the UK.
  • Operators must comply with all relevant legal and regulatory requirements for providing home-to-school transport services.
  • Operators must meet the general criteria to be admitted onto the DPS framework agreement.
🔧

TECHNICAL CAPABILITY REQUIREMENTS

  • Operators must demonstrate the technical capability to provide home-to-school transport services.
  • Operators must possess suitable vehicles and qualified personnel to deliver the required transport services safely and efficiently.
  • Operators must have appropriate licenses, permits, and insurance for passenger transport.
💰

FINANCIAL REQUIREMENTS

  • Operators must demonstrate sufficient financial standing to perform the contract obligations.
  • Operators must be financially stable and solvent.
📋

SUBMISSION REQUIREMENTS

  • Submit a complete application to join the DPS framework agreement by the specified deadline.
  • All required information and documentation must be provided as part of the application.
  • Submissions must adhere to the format and instructions provided by Blackburn with Darwen.
  • The submission deadline is 2027-04-20 11:00:00.
